**Ticket: Staging env misconfigured for reset-flow revamp**

While testing the revamped password reset flow on Quillbend staging, Marta noticed that reset emails were silently dropped. The root cause is that staging was cloned from the old Harrowgate template, which predates the new token-signing service. The flow now signs reset links server-side, and without the signing secret the mailer aborts before enqueueing. To unblock QA before Thursday's release cut, each staging box needs its env file updated with this line:

env line for fafof-fahag: LEDGER_TOKEN5=f8790

# Provenance: Larkspur Profile Store Sharding

For reviewers: all Larkspur shard-migration binaries are produced by the sealed Ironbell pipeline, with source revision and dependency digests recorded at build time. Do not approve shard-topology changes unless the attached attestation matches the pipeline record. Unattested artifacts are rejected at deploy. The artifact under review is identified by the token below.

trace token, kajeg-bajop: htk6_46382d

Leadership Review Briefing — Insurance Renewal

The Hollowmere Group's property and liability cover with Tarnwick Mutual renews at quarter-end. Quoted premium is up fourteen percent, driven by the Selden Point warehouse expansion. Deductibles are unchanged; cyber cover remains excluded and is quoted separately. Brokers advise accepting the terms. The strategic consideration behind this recommendation appears below.

board note of fahif-hahop: The steering committee signed off on a budget of $63.9 million for Project Ulaath. The renewal with Ralvanox Systems closes at $63.0 million a year, 58 percent below the last contract.

// --- Thornbill Admin Dashboard: theme client setup ---
// Welcome aboard! This block wires up the ThemeSync client that
// powers dark-mode support across the admin dashboard. Short
// version: user theme prefs live in the Lampwick service, and we
// fetch/push them through this client so toggles persist across
// sessions and devices. Don't hardcode colors anywhere — pull
// tokens from the theme payload or designers will hunt you down.
// The client authenticates against Lampwick with the key below:

gateway credential: kto23_dolYgAScEh2TaPOlStqOl98